Output 851d88cfca738e5ecb6f3f818071b4e46f0f97fd8e3337537c4e1d368b0f130c:1

value
180023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41706270d39cf6130009295e062d78e1c28c82b4 OP_EQUAL
address
37f2UdKfVXnuK2SxEmRCQngV5eZ4qMpqNq
transaction
851d88cfca738e5ecb6f3f818071b4e46f0f97fd8e3337537c4e1d368b0f130c
confirmations
159791
spent
true